Natural World: 31x14

Unnatural History Of London

Seals, parakeets and even pelicans that eat pigeons have all made London their home. That’s as well as badgers, foxes, scorpions, and pigeons that ride the tube. But even more wonderful are the people who love the exotic wildlife of our capital, from Billingsgate fish porters to Indian Chefs to ‘Crayfish Bob’, who scours London’s canals for Turkish invaders. This is a warm-hearted portrait of the world’s greenest capital city and the Londoners who love its secret wildlife.
